Water Footprint
SS_10-02It is a device to learn the amount of water required for the production of different foods and clothes. As the barcodes on the device panel are scanned, the water credit on the screen decreases according to the product. If the credit is insufficient, the amount of water required for the product is also indicated and the warning that the balance is insufficient is displayed on the screen. The button on the table allows visitors to try again by resetting the credit amount.

Water Use at Home
SS_06-02When the buttons in the device are pressed, the number of water drops proportional to the amount of water consumed during the relevant activity is illuminated with an LED display on the panel. There will be 9 buttons in total; hand and face washing, tooth brushing, toilet flushing, bathroom, saving faucet (min), leaky faucet (min), hand dishwashing, dishwasher and washing machine. More than one button cannot be pressed simultaneously.

Wheeled Seesaw
TB_05-02The movement of the seesaw creates a rotational effect on the shaft at its center. With this
effect you rotate the gears connected to each other on the board. As the seesaw moves up and down
, the gears rotate clockwise and counterclockwise
.TB_05-02 -
